สร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B สำหรับธุรกิจไทย
Estimated reading time: 10 minutes
- Remix และ FaunaDB เป็นเทคโนโลยีที่เหมาะสมสำหรับการพัฒนาแ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ัย
- การรักษาความปลอดภัยของข้อมูลลูกค้าเป็นสิ่งสำคัญที่สุดสำหรับธุรกิจออนไลน์
- การวางแผนและการออกแบบที่ดีเป็นพื้นฐานสำหรับการสร้างแพลตฟอร์มอีคอมเมิร์ซที่ประสบความสำเร็จ
- การปรึกษาผู้เชี่ยวชาญช่วยให้ธุรกิจสามารถนำเทคโนโลยีมาประยุกต์ใช้ได้อย่างมีประสิทธิภาพ
Table of Contents
- ความสำคัญของแ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ัย
- ทำไมต้อง Remix และ FaunaDB?
- ข้อดีของการใช้ Remix และ FaunaDB สำหรับแพลตฟอร์มอีคอมเมิร์ซ
- ขั้นตอนการส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B
- รายละเอียดทางเทคนิคที่สำคัญ
- ตัวอย่างโค้ด (JavaScript)
- คำแนะนำสำหรับธุรกิจไทย
- การปรับใช้ Digital Transformation และ Business Solutions
- บริการของเรา
- Call to Action
- แหล่งข้อมูลเพิ่มเติม
- FAQ
ความสำคัญของแ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ัย
ในยุคดิจิทัลที่การซื้อขายออนไลน์เติบโตอย่างรวดเร็ว ความปลอดภัยของแพลตฟอร์มอีคอมเมิร์ซเป็นสิ่งสำคัญอย่างยิ่งต่อความสำเร็จของธุรกิจไทย บทความนี้จะเจาะลึกถึงวิธีการส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B สำหรับธุรกิจไทย ซึ่งเป็นเทคโนโลยีที่ทันสมัยและมีประสิทธิภาพในการสร้างประสบการณ์การซื้อขายออนไลน์ที่น่าเชื่อถือและปลอดภัย
การส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ยไม่ใช่แค่เรื่องของการป้องกันการโจรกรรมข้อมูลเท่านั้น แต่ยังรวมถึงการสร้างความไว้วางใจและความมั่นใจให้กับลูกค้าที่เข้ามาใช้บริการ ซึ่งส่งผลโดยตรงต่อชื่อเสียงและความสำเร็จของธุรกิจ นอกจากนี้ การละเลยเรื่องความปลอดภัยอาจนำไปสู่ปัญหาทางกฎหมายและการสูญเสียทางการเงินได้
- ความไว้วางใจของลูกค้า: ลูกค้าย่อมต้องการความมั่นใจว่าข้อมูลส่วนตัวและการทำธุรกรรมทางการเงินของพวกเขาจะได้รับการปกป้องอย่างดี
- การรักษาชื่อเสียง: การถูกโจมตีทางไซเบอร์และการรั่วไหลของข้อมูลสามารถทำลายชื่อเสียงของธุรกิจได้อย่างรวดเร็ว
- การปฏิบัติตามกฎหมาย: กฎหมายคุ้มครองข้อมูลส่วนบุคคล (PDPA) กำหนดให้ธุรกิจต้องมีมาตรการรักษาความปลอดภัยที่เหมาะสมเพื่อปกป้องข้อมูลของลูกค้า
- การป้องกันการสูญเสียทางการเงิน: การโจรกรรมข้อมูลและการฉ้อโกงสามารถนำไปสู่การสูญเสียทางการเงินอย่างมาก
ทำไมต้อง Remix และ FaunaDB?
Remix และ FaunaDB เป็นเทคโนโลยีที่น่าสนใจและเหมาะสมอย่างยิ่งสำหรับการพัฒนาแ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ยสำหรับธุรกิจไทย
- Remix: เป็นเฟรมเวิร์กเว็บสมัยใหม่ที่ใช้ React และ Node.js เน้นประสิทธิภาพ ความสามารถในการเข้าถึง และประสบการณ์ของผู้ใช้ที่ดีเยี่ยม Remix มีคุณสมบัติที่ช่วยให้การพัฒนาเว็บไซต์เป็นไปอย่างรวดเร็วและง่ายดาย รวมถึงการจัดการข้อมูลและการสร้างอินเทอร์เฟซที่ใช้งานง่าย นอกจากนี้ Remix ยังมีระบบความปลอดภัยในตัวที่ช่วยป้องกันการโจมตีทางไซเบอร์
- FaunaDB: เป็นฐานข้อมูลแบบกระจาย (distributed database) ที่มีความสามารถในการปรับขนาดได้สูง (scalable) และมีความปลอดภัยเป็นพิเศษ FaunaDB ใช้สถาปัตยกรรมแบบ decentralized ที่ทำให้ยากต่อการถูกโจมตี และมีระบบการจัดการสิทธิ์และการเข้าถึงข้อมูลที่ละเอียด ทำให้มั่นใจได้ว่าข้อมูลจะถูกเก็บรักษาอย่างปลอดภัย
ข้อดีของการใช้ Remix และ FaunaDB สำหรับแพลตฟอร์มอีคอมเมิร์ซ:
- ความปลอดภัยสูง: ทั้ง Remix และ FaunaDB มีคุณสมบัติที่ช่วยให้การพัฒนาแ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ยเป็นไปได้ง่ายขึ้น
- ประสิทธิภาพ: Remix เน้นประสิทธิภาพและความเร็วในการโหลดหน้าเว็บ ในขณะที่ FaunaDB มีความสามารถในการปรับขนาดได้สูง ทำให้แพลตฟอร์มสามารถรองรับปริมาณการใช้งานที่เพิ่มขึ้นได้อย่างราบรื่น
- ความยืดหยุ่น: Remix และ FaunaDB สามารถปรับแต่งให้เข้ากับความต้องการของธุรกิจได้หลากหลาย
- ความง่ายในการพัฒนา: Remix มี API ที่ใช้งานง่ายและเอกสารประกอบที่ครบถ้วน ทำให้การพัฒนาเว็บไซต์เป็นไปอย่างรวดเร็วและง่ายดาย
ขั้นตอนการส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B:
- การวางแผนและการออกแบบ: กำหนดความต้องการของธุรกิจและออกแบบสถาปัตยกรรมของแพลตฟอร์ม รวมถึงการออกแบบฐานข้อมูลและการจัดการข้อมูล
- การตั้งค่า Remix: ติดตั้งและตั้งค่า Remix โดยใช้ Node.js และ npm (Node Package Manager)
- การเชื่อมต่อกับ FaunaDB: สร้างบัญชี FaunaDB และตั้งค่าการเชื่อมต่อกับ Remix โดยใช้ API key
- การพัฒนาส่วนหน้า (Frontend): ใช้ React และ JSX เพื่อสร้างอินเทอร์เฟซผู้ใช้ที่ใช้งานง่ายและสวยงาม
- การพัฒนาส่วนหลัง (Backend): ใช้ Node.js และ Remix API เพื่อจัดการข้อมูล การตรวจสอบสิทธิ์ และการทำธุรกรรม
- การรักษาความปลอดภัย: ใช้คุณสมบัติความปลอดภัยของ Remix และ FaunaDB เพื่อป้องกันการโจมตีทางไซเบอร์ เช่น การป้องกัน Cross-Site Scripting (XSS) และ SQL Injection
- การทดสอบและการปรับปรุง: ทดสอบแพลตฟอร์มอย่างละเอียดและปรับปรุงแก้ไขข้อผิดพลาด
- การนำไปใช้งาน: นำแพลตฟอร์มไปใช้งานและตรวจสอบประสิทธิภาพอย่างต่อเนื่อง
รายละเอียดทางเทคนิคที่สำคัญ:
- Authentication and Authorization: การยืนยันตัวตนและการให้สิทธิ์ผู้ใช้งานเป็นสิ่งสำคัญอย่างยิ่งในการรักษาความปลอดภัยของแพลตฟอร์มอีคอมเมิร์ซ Remix มีเครื่องมือที่ช่วยให้การจัดการ Authentication และ Authorization เป็นไปได้ง่ายขึ้น เช่น การใช้ cookies หรือ JSON Web Tokens (JWT)
- Data Validation: การตรวจสอบข้อมูลที่ผู้ใช้ป้อนเข้ามาเป็นสิ่งสำคัญในการป้องกันการโจมตีแบบ SQL Injection และ XSS Remix มีเครื่องมือที่ช่วยให้การตรวจสอบข้อมูลเป็นไปได้ง่ายขึ้น เช่น การใช้ libraries อย่าง Zod หรือ Yup
- Rate Limiting: การจำกัดจำนวนคำขอที่ผู้ใช้สามารถส่งไปยังเซิร์ฟเวอร์เป็นสิ่งสำคัญในการป้องกันการโจมตีแบบ Denial-of-Service (DoS) Remix มี middleware ที่ช่วยให้การจำกัดอัตราการส่งคำขอเป็นไปได้ง่ายขึ้น
- Content Security Policy (CSP): CSP เป็นกลไกที่ช่วยป้องกันการโจมตีแบบ XSS โดยการจำกัดแหล่งที่มาของเนื้อหาที่สามารถโหลดเข้ามาในหน้าเว็บ Remix สามารถกำหนด CSP ได้ง่ายๆ ผ่าน HTTP headers
- HTTPS: การใช้ HTTPS เป็นสิ่งจำเป็นสำหรับการเข้ารหัสข้อมูลที่ส่งระหว่างผู้ใช้และเซิร์ฟเวอร์ Remix สนับสนุน HTTPS โดยอัตโนมัติ
ตัวอย่างโค้ด (JavaScript):
// ตัวอย่างการเชื่อมต่อกับ FaunaDB ใน Remix
import { createFaunaClient } from "~/utils/fauna";
export async function loader() {
const client = createFaunaClient();
const products = await client.query(/* FQL query to fetch products */);
return { products };
}
export default function Products() {
const { products } = useLoaderData();
return (
<ul>
{products.map((product) => (
<li key={product.id}>{product.name}</li>
))}
</ul>
);
}
คำแนะนำสำหรับธุรกิจไทย:
- ปรึกษาผู้เชี่ยวชาญ: หากคุณไม่มีความรู้ความเข้าใจเกี่ยวกับ Remix และ FaunaDB มากนัก ควรปรึกษาผู้เชี่ยวชาญด้าน IT consulting และ software development เพื่อขอคำแนะนำและความช่วยเหลือ
- เริ่มต้นจากขนาดเล็ก: ไม่จำเป็นต้องสร้างแพลตฟอร์มอีคอมเมิร์ซขนาดใหญ่ในทันที เริ่มต้นจากขนาดเล็กและค่อยๆ ขยายขนาดตามความต้องการของธุรกิจ
- ให้ความสำคัญกับความปลอดภัย: อย่าประนีประนอมเรื่องความปลอดภัย ให้ความสำคัญกับการรักษาความปลอดภัยของข้อมูลลูกค้าเป็นอันดับแรก
- ติดตามเทคโนโลยีใหม่ๆ: เทคโนโลยีมีการเปลี่ยนแปลงอยู่เสมอ ดังนั้นควรติดตามเทคโนโลยีใหม่ๆ และปรับปรุงแพลตฟอร์มอีคอมเมิร์ซของคุณให้ทันสมัยอยู่เสมอ
การปรับใช้ Digital Transformation และ Business Solutions:
การส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B เป็นส่วนหนึ่งของกระบวนการ Digital Transformation ที่จะช่วยให้ธุรกิจไทยสามารถปรับตัวเข้ากับการเปลี่ยนแปลงทางดิจิทัลและเพิ่มขีดความสามารถในการแข่งขันในตลาดโลกได้ นอกจากนี้ การใช้เทคโนโลยีที่ทันสมัยยังช่วยให้ธุรกิจสามารถสร้าง Business Solutions ที่ตอบโจทย์ความต้องการของลูกค้าและเพิ่มประสิทธิภาพในการดำเนินงาน
บริการของเรา:
บริษัทของเรามีความเชี่ยวชาญด้าน IT consulting, software development, Digital Transformation และ Business Solutions เรามีทีมงานที่มีประสบการณ์ในการพัฒนาแ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B เราสามารถช่วยคุณสร้างแพลตฟอร์มอีคอมเมิร์ซที่ตอบโจทย์ความต้องการของธุรกิจของคุณและเพิ่มขีดความสามารถในการแข่งขันในตลาด
Call to Action:
หากคุณสนใจที่จะสร้างแพลตฟอร์มอีคอมเมิร์ซที่ปลอดภัยด้วย Remix และ FaunaDB หรือต้องการคำปรึกษาด้าน IT consulting, software development, Digital Transformation และ Business Solutions ติดต่อเราวันนี้เพื่อขอคำแนะนำและข้อมูลเพิ่มเติม! ติดต่อ มีศิริ ดิจิทัล
แหล่งข้อมูลเพิ่มเติม:
- Remix: https://remix.run/
- FaunaDB: https://fauna.com/
- PDPA: https://www.mdes.go.th/th/page/category/detail/id/91 (เว็บไซต์กระทรวงดิจิทัลเพื่อเศรษฐกิจและสังคมเกี่ยวกับ PDPA)
FAQ
No FAQ content provided.